Pune, 29th April 2024: The Board of Directors of Poonawalla Fincorp Limited, a non-deposit taking systemically important NBFC focusing on consumer and MSME finance, today announced its audited financial results for the quarter and year ended March 31, 2024.

The Company continued to register robust financial performance, demonstrating strong growth in AUM, Profitability, and superior asset quality.

Key Highlights – Q4FY24:

Assets:

Highest Ever Quarterly Disbursement: Achieved the highest ever quarterly disbursement of ₹ 9,688 crore, up 52% YoY and 11% QoQ

Assets Under Management (AUM): Stood at ₹ 25,003 crore, up 55% YoY and 14% QoQ

Asset Quality:

Gross NPA at 1.16%, reduced by 28 bps YoY and 17 bps QoQ

Net NPA at 0.59%, reduced by 19 bps YoY and 11 bps QoQ

Profitability:

Profit After Tax (PAT): Highest ever yearly PAT of ₹ 1027 crore in FY24, jumps 83% YoY and Highest ever quarterly PAT of ₹ 332 crore, up 25% QoQ

Return on Assets (RoA) stood at 5.73%, up 73 bps YoY and 42 bps QoQ

Net Interest Margin (NIM) was at 11.06%, up 4 bps QoQ

Opex to AUM ratio: At 3.99% in Q4FY24, reduced by 144 bps YoY and 1 bps QoQ
Operating Profit (PPOP) was at ₹ 409 crore for Q4FY24, up 93% YoY and 17% QoQ

Capital Adequacy and Liquidity:

Capital Adequacy Ratio stood at 33.8%

Liquidity buffer stood at ₹ 3,932 crore
